Understanding Filling Machines: A Brief Overview

Filling machines are essential equipment used to dispense products into containers, ranging from liquids and powders to granules and pastes. The primary goal of these machines is to ensure that products are filled accurately and consistently, minimizing waste and maximizing efficiency. They are widely used across various industries, including food and beverage, pharmaceuticals, cosmetics, and chemicals.

Current Trends in Filling Machine Technology

The landscape of filling machine technology is continuously changing, driven by advancements in automation, smart manufacturing, and sustainability. Below are some of the most significant trends shaping the industry:

1. Automation and Smart Technologies

Automation has become a cornerstone of modern manufacturing processes. Filling machines are increasingly integrated with advanced control systems that allow for real-time monitoring and adjustments. Smart technologies, such as the Internet of Things (IoT), enable machines to communicate with each other and with operators, enhancing efficiency and reducing downtime.

2. Sustainability Initiatives

As global awareness of environmental issues grows, manufacturers are seeking ways to make their processes more sustainable. Filling machines are being designed with energy-efficient components and materials that minimize waste. Additionally, many companies are adopting refillable and recyclable packaging solutions, which require filling machines that can accommodate diverse container types.

3. Customization and Flexibility

With the rise of personalized products and smaller batch sizes, there is a growing demand for filling machines that can be easily customized. Modern machines are designed to handle various product types and container sizes, allowing manufacturers to switch between different products without extensive downtime or reconfiguration.

Innovations in Filling Machine Design

Innovation is at the heart of the filling machine industry, with new designs and technologies emerging to meet the evolving needs of manufacturers. Here are some noteworthy innovations:

1. Magnetic Drive Technology

Magnetic drive technology is revolutionizing the filling process by eliminating traditional mechanical components. This technology reduces wear and tear, leading to longer machine life and lower maintenance costs. Moreover, it allows for precise control over filling speeds and volumes, ensuring consistent product quality.

2. Augmented Reality (AR) for Maintenance and Training

Augmented reality is being increasingly utilized in the training and maintenance of filling machines. AR applications can overlay digital information onto the physical machine, assisting operators in troubleshooting and maintenance tasks. This technology enhances training efficiency and reduces the likelihood of human error.

3. Advanced Sensors and Data Analytics

The integration of advanced sensors and data analytics in filling machines enables manufacturers to collect and analyze vast amounts of operational data. This information can be used to optimize production processes, predict maintenance needs, and improve overall equipment effectiveness (OEE).

Choosing the Right Filling Machine: Practical Considerations

When selecting a filling machine, manufacturers must consider several factors to ensure they choose the right equipment for their specific needs. Here are some practical considerations:

1. Product Characteristics

Understanding the physical and chemical properties of the product being filled is crucial. Factors such as viscosity, temperature sensitivity, and particulate content can significantly influence the choice of filling machine. For instance, highly viscous products may require piston fillers, while free-flowing liquids might be best suited for gravity fillers.

2. Container Types and Sizes

The range of container types and sizes that a filling machine can accommodate is another critical factor. Manufacturers should assess their current and future packaging needs, ensuring that the chosen machine can handle various formats, including bottles, jars, pouches, and bulk containers.

3. Production Speed and Efficiency

Production speed is a vital consideration, especially for high-demand industries. Manufacturers should evaluate their throughput requirements and select a filling machine that can meet or exceed these demands while maintaining accuracy and consistency.

4. Compliance and Regulatory Standards

In industries such as pharmaceuticals and food and beverage, compliance with regulatory standards is paramount. Manufacturers must ensure that the filling machine adheres to industry regulations, such as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P) and Food and Drug Administration (FDA) guidelines.
